Default Aquascaping Epoxy Question

Hey guys,

just doing some aquascaping here and wondering what the best approach is towards gluing two rocks together a bit? Can you kneed the epoxy out of the water and then dunk it under and shove it between the two points you want glued together or do you need to do this out of the water?

What other tips would you guys offer?

it can be done underwater easier. imo, might want to shut your skimmer down while doing it as some brands can make them bubble pretty crazy for a while.

I mix my epoxy out of the water then attach the rocks or frags under water. It has quite long curing time so you don't need to rush. I also have used black zip ties to hold rocks together. So people have said that the clear ones break down under UV rays.
